    [size=52]The ninth cabinet of the Kurdistan government is implementing 201 investment projects with a capital exceeding $11 billion[/size]

    [size=45]The Department of Information and Information in the Kurdistan Regional Government announced that during the three years of the ninth cabin, 201 investment projects were implemented in different regions of the region, with a capital of more than 11 billion dollars.[/size]
    [size=45]The department said in a statement that the Kurdistan Regional Government agreed to implement 201 investment projects with a capital of 11 billion 562 million 93 thousand dollars on an area of ​​10 thousand 603 dunums in separate areas of the Kurdistan Region implemented by local investors.[/size]
    [size=45]She added that the projects were distributed among the governorates and independent administrations, and most of these projects were implemented in Erbil Governorate.[/size]
    [size=45]Projects in 2019
    In 2019, the beginning of the ninth ministerial cabinet, 16 projects were licensed, all of which were by local investors, with a capital of 485 million dollars 204 thousand 256 dollars.[/size]
    [size=45]Projects in 2020
    In 2020, when the “Corona” epidemic spread around the world and the Kurdistan Region was not immune from its negative effects, 76 projects were licensed that year, including two projects that were implemented jointly by local and foreign investors.[/size]
    [size=45]The total project capital amounted to $1.984 billion, of which $1.967 billion was invested by local investors and $17.566 million through joint ventures.[/size]
    [size=45]Projects in 2021
    In 2021, projects continued, as 70 different projects were licensed, of which only one project was through foreign investors, and one joint project, and 68 other projects were implemented by local investors with a capital of $8 billion, 515 million, 645 thousand and 864 dollars. .[/size]
    [size=45]2022 Projects In
    the first six months of 2022, the Kurdistan Regional Government granted licenses to 35 investment projects in various fields with a capital of $330,696,265, all of which were implemented by local authorities.[/size]
    [size=45]Total projects
    Accordingly, the ninth cabinet of the Kurdistan Regional Government licensed 201 projects in different sectors with a capital of 11 billion and 562 million 93 thousand dollars, and they were implemented on an area of ​​10 thousand 603 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]The projects are divided according to governorates and independent administrations, and most of these projects were implemented in Erbil governorate.[/size]
    [size=45]Erbil Governorate Erbil
    Governorate received 87 projects with a capital of 8 billion 906 million 806 thousand 129 dollars. The projects were implemented on an area of ​​4 thousand 861 dunums.[/size]
    [size=45]Sulaymaniyah Governorate The Sulaymaniyah
    Governorate comes in second place with 53 projects with a capital of 559 million 982 thousand 213 dollars on an area of ​​928 thousand acres.[/size]
    [size=45]Dohuk Governorate
    In the Dohuk Governorate, 45 projects were implemented with a capital of 589 million and 554 thousand and 88 dollars on an area of ​​two thousand 750 dunums.[/size]
    [size=45]Governor of Halabja
    In the province of Halabja, a project was implemented with a capital of 6 million 846 thousand dollars on an area of ​​7 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]Garmian independent
    administration In Garmian administration 10 projects were implemented with a capital of 333 million and 475 thousand and 89 dollars on an area of ​​935 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]The independent Raprin administration
    has implemented five projects in the Raprin administration at a cost of 125 million 429 thousand and 481 dollars on an area of ​​119 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]Projects by sectors
    One of the most important sectors in which projects were implemented is the commercial sector with a total of 49 projects with a capital of 638 million and 265 thousand and 11 dollars on an area of ​​709 dunums.[/size]
    [size=45]The projects of the two banks amounted to a capital of 19.415 million dollars on an area of ​​1.2 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]There were 12 health projects with a capital of 92 million 345 thousand and 500 on an area of ​​15 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]There were 58 industrial projects with a capital of one billion and 771 million and 220 thousand and 943 dollars and an area of ​​two thousand 190 acres of land.[/size]
    [size=45]There was one service project with a capital of 9 million and 491 thousand on an area of ​​21 dunums, in addition to 29 tourism projects with a capital of 7 billion 122 million and 606 thousand and 299 dollars on an area of ​​​​2 thousand 856 dunums of land.[/size]
    [size=45]Education projects amounted to 21 projects with a capital of 229,946,290 dollars on an area of ​​542 dunums.[/size]
    [size=45]As for the agricultural projects, they were 8 projects with a capital of 320 million and 669 thousand and 500 dollars on an area of ​​2 thousand 879 dunums of land.[/size]
    [size=45]The housing sector projects amounted to 13 projects with a capital of 1.288 million and 168,000 dollars on an area of ​​1,351 dunums.[/size]
    [size=45]In the arts sector, one project with a capital of $9.234 million was implemented on an area of ​​10 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]In the sports sector, 7 projects were implemented with a capital of $60,731,457 on an area of ​​25 acres.[/size]
    [size=45]Local Projects
    Among the 201 projects that were licensed during the three years of the ninth booth, 197 projects were implemented by local companies and investors, and only one project was implemented by foreign investors, and three projects were implemented jointly.[/size]
    [size=45]Total capital of projects
    The total capital of projects executed by local companies and local investors amounted to 6 billion and 618 million and 559 thousand dollars, and the capital of the three joint projects amounted to 37 million and 384 thousand dollars.[/size]
    [size=45]The only project implemented by a foreign company was with a capital of $4.906 billion.[/size]
